Setting Up Effective Follow-Up Reminders for Customer Inquiries

In the fast-paced world of sales, timely follow-ups can make the difference between closing a deal and losing a potential customer. Setting up reminders for follow-ups on customer inquiries is crucial to ensure that no potential sale slips through the cracks.

The Importance of Follow-Up Reminders

Follow-up reminders help sales teams stay organized and proactive. They ensure that inquiries are addressed promptly, which can significantly enhance customer satisfaction and increase conversion rates. Without a structured follow-up system, businesses risk losing leads and revenue.

  • 1 Increased conversion rates
  • 2 Improved customer satisfaction
  • 3 Enhanced team accountability
  • 4 Better tracking of customer interactions

How to Set Up Follow-Up Reminders

To effectively set up follow-up reminders, consider the following steps:

  1. 1 Identify key touchpoints in the customer journey.
  2. 2 Use a centralized platform to manage customer inquiries.
  3. 3 Set specific timeframes for follow-ups based on inquiry type.
  4. 4 Utilize customizable commands to automate reminders.
  5. 5 Monitor and adjust follow-up strategies based on performance metrics.
